NO adjustable timing on the Blaster.... You have not given too much info about the actual trouble...But this time of year..depending on where your from, Is when most people start seeing jetting problems with the changes in Temp as spring rolls in.... But if you never changed your jets for winter...I would look towards a dirty carb, air leak in the carb boots, dirty filter, oil change, Spark plug?....I know some things seem abvious. But often the little things get missed until it's too late.

I have had this happen on 2 stroke motorcycles, did it backfire before it started to go backwards if so it spun the crank in the oppsite direction then it was disigned to. There for it seemed to have rev. Simply put the engine was running backwards . Find out what is causing it to run the way it is . It is more than likely one of problems listed by sayit fmf above.
